New York Asbestos Lawyers

New York is one of the nation's most active areas for asbestos litigation. Every year hundreds of asbestos legal lawsuits in New York are filed. Many of these lawsuits are filed by people who have suffered from asbestos-related diseases like mesothelioma and other asbestos-related diseases. These lawsuits are typically filed against companies who exposed workers to asbestos at work. An experienced mesothelioma lawyer can assist those suffering from mesothelioma and their families to seek compensation for their loss.

The mesothelioma lawyers in the firm of Weitz & Luxenberg have helped hundreds of clients in New York receive compensation for their injuries. They work on a contingent basis that means they won't be paid until they win an award or settlement for their client. The lawyers are knowledgeable about federal asbestos laws and New York statutes. They are also knowledgeable about the different types of mesothelioma cases which must be filed.

Thousands of patients have been diagnosed with mesothelioma within the New York area alone. Many of these patients were exposed to asbestos while working in shipyards, construction, and auto manufacturing industries. Patients who suffer from asbestos-related disease often require extensive medical treatment. The money received from mesothelioma lawsuits that are successful can help pay for these treatments.

An asbestos lawyer can help you file a workers ' compensation claim, personal injury lawsuit or a wrongful-death suit. Workers' compensation might seem like a sensible alternative if exposure to asbestos occurred on a job site however, workers' compensation benefits usually do not cover all the costs of a victim's losses.

Mesothelioma victims in New York should contact a mesothelioma lawyer firm that can offer free consultations and representation for their case. During this consultation an attorney will describe the kinds of legal claims available to them and address any questions they may have. The attorney will also explain the statute of limitations which is the period within which they are able to file a lawsuit. In New York, the statute of limitations is typically two years after the date of death of a loved one, or three years from the date of the diagnosis.
